A Python library for automating interaction with websites. MechanicalSoup
automatically stores and sends cookies, follows redirects, and can follow
links and submit forms. It doesn't do Javascript.
MechanicalSoup provides a similar API to the Mechanize library using Requests
(for http sessions) and BeautifulSoup (for document navigation).
This package provides the library for Python 2.


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install python-mechanicalsoup deb package:
    # sudo apt-get install python-mechanicalsoup




2017-05-16 - Ghislain Antony Vaillant <>
python-mechanicalsoup (0.7.0-1) unstable; urgency=medium
* Swith from git-dpm to gbp
- Drop git-dpm configuration
- Add gbp configuration
* Fix typo in watch regex
* Fixup Vcs-Browser URI
* New upstream version 0.7.0
* Bump minimum Py3 version to 3.3
* Exclude egg-info directory via extend-diff-ignore
* Add DEP-8 tests, drop superfluous Testsuite field
2016-12-27 - Ghislain Antony Vaillant <>
python-mechanicalsoup (0.6.0-1) unstable; urgency=low
* Initial release. (Closes: #849475)

